Time taken by a boat to cover 180 km in downstream is
the same as to cover 140 km in upstream. Find the time taken by the boat to cover 360 km in downstream, if the speed of the boat in still water is 40 km/h.Solution
ATQ, Let the speed of the stream be 'x' km/h. ATQ: We know that, Downstream speed of a boat = Speed of the boat in still water + speed of the stream Upstream speed of a boat = Speed of the boat in still water - speed of the stream 9(40−x) = 7(40+x) 360−9x = 280+7x 16x = 80 x = 80/16 x = 5 Therefore, speed of the stream = 5 km/h Therefore, time taken to cover 360 km in downstream = 360/(40+5) = 360/45 = 8 hrs
